A process in which what needs attending to, While someone might actually think that Elvis Presley has a hound dog who happens to be particularly noisy, imagine if his lyric went Youre like a hound dog, or Youre as whiny as a hound dog. In these cases, Elvis would be using a simile, which makes it a bit clearer that hes not actually singing to a sad puppy.
